Solution for What is 855 increased by 10 percent? (855 plus 10%):

855 + (10/100 * 855) = 940.5

Now we have: 855 increased by 10 percent = 940.5

Question: What is 855 increased by 10 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 855.

Step 2: We have b with value of 10.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 855 + (\frac{10}{100} * 855).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{940.5}

Therefore, {855} increased by {10\%} is {940.5}
